The LG B1 delivers the precise and deep HDR contrast that the best OLED TVs are known for, but for a lower price compared to the LG C1. It gets there by trimming back in a couple of areas, but they're all areas we can very much accept for the price, because the most important stuff is all so good.
For example, while you get the same kind of excellent, rich OLED colours as the LG C1, you get a slightly less advanced image processor – but one that's still able to match the quality of other mid-range TVs no question.
And while you still get HDMI 2.1 support with 4K 120Hz and VRR gaming (including FreeSync and G-Sync), plus LG's useful Game Optimizer software, only two of the four HDMI ports on the LG B1 support HDMI 2.1 features, whereas all four ports on the LG C1 support HDMI 2.1.
When it comes to smart TV tech, the B1 includes LG's excellent webOS software, which is stuffed with key streaming services – the same as you get on any of the best LG TVs.
Aside from a super-sharp 4K picture, you've got support for Dolby Vision HDR, including Dolby Vision gaming at 120Hz from the Xbox Series X – and this one of only a handful of TVs to offer it.
Dolby Atmos support means movies, TV and supporting games sound as good as possible – and there's Filmmaker Mode included for purist movie fans.
